A biker is a biker is a biker.

Even the kids on scooters without gloves, wearing tracksuits & their lids not fastened, get a nod or a wave.

ANPR - Automatic Number Plate Recognition (a way to enforce road tax on vehicles etc). Some have speed cameras in them too, and generally mean a LOT of police presence on a section of road. Round these parts they're really hated! Richard Brunstrom (local cheif plod), by all acounts, spends his days off manning the ANPR vans.

Back to the topic:

Who's to say that a biker on a scooter (so long as they have all gear on), isn't only on that because their bike is off the road for some reason.

Why emergency services? Well, at some point I'm going to meet the tarmac at considerable force, and they're the ones that are going to scrape me up & possibly put me in a bag.

Recovery services? Well, I'm covered by 4 different recovery policies, so one of them will probably be out to me next time the bike breaks down!

EDIT: I also have distinct signs for "police ahead" or "no police around" (which include a rough distance) & a "roadworks round the next bend" type thing.
